AirTrain service at New York JFK Airport

Airtrain at JFK airport

The 24-hour AirTrain JFK is the fastest and easiest way to get around JFK Airport. The system connects all passenger terminals to the parking garages, the hotel shuttle pick-up area, the rental car center and New York's public transportation network at Jamaica and Howard Beach stations, where you can make connections to the subway, trains and public buses.

Fares

The AirTrain is free for use within the airport grounds. If you start or end your trip at the Jamaica or Howard Beach stations, a fee of USD8.25 applies, payable by MetroCard (which costs USD1.00). To board the subway, you must pay an extra USD2.90. These can be purchased at the machines located at Jamaica and Howard Beach stations, at the Hudson News stores in Terminals 1, 4, 7 and 8, or at any MTA subway station.

* You can use an Unlimited Ride MetroCard or OMNY card on the subway, but not on the AirTrain.

Between Terminals

The AirTrain connects all passenger terminals. This service is free of charge. Normally, the Jamaica and Howard Beach lines operate in the following order: Terminal 1, Terminal 4, Terminal 5, Terminal 7, Terminal 8, and then proceeds to its origin station. The Central Terminal Train operates in reverse order and only runs between terminals.

Any changes to that routine will be reflected on the AirTrain platform information monitors.

To and from NYC Public Transportation

The AirTrain connects to New York's public transportation network at Jamaica and Howard Beach stations.

To and from the Parking Lots

AirTrain stations are located adjacent to each terminal's short-term parking lot.

Long-term parking lots are located near the Lefferts Boulevard station, which is connected to the terminals by the Howard Beach Line.

Transportation to and from the hotel and rental cars

All airport shuttles and rental car facilities are located at the AirTrain Federal Circle station, which is accessible via the Jamaica and Howard Beach lines.

Accessibility

All AirTrain trains and stations are ADA-compliant and are equipped with elevators and escalators. There are two designated wheelchair locations on each vehicle. Wheelchair-accessible connectors are available at Jamaica and Howard Beach stations to and from the rail and subway platforms.

For the hearing impaired, there are visual signals on the train and at the stations. For the visually impaired, there are destination announcements on board the train and guide dogs are welcome. There are also tactile warning surfaces on the platforms, as well as signs in Braille and raised lettering.
